Transaction 5bc672946b0a75dbc07a9a7523ea7529485b874dc992ff93610a412608f3927e
1 Input
1 Output
-
5bc672946b0a75dbc07a9a7523ea7529485b874dc992ff93610a412608f3927e:0
- value
- 592629
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6593bbf42b2e503d55df5eb636e58f408167020
- address
- bc1q6evnh06zktjs842a7h4kxmjc7sypvupqm097s7